#297027 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#297027 is composed of 16.1% red, 43.9%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 118.4 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 29.6%. #297027 color hex could be obtained by blending #52e04e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#297027 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#297027 has RGB values of R:41, G:112,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2715687.

Hex triplet 297027 #297027
RGB Decimal 41, 112, 39 rgb(41,112,39)
RGB Percent 16.1, 43.9, 15.3 rgb(16.1%,43.9%,15.3%)
CMYK 63, 0, 65, 56
HSL 118.4°, 48.3, 29.6 hsl(118.4,48.3%,29.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 118.4°, 65.2, 43.9
Web Safe 336633 #336633
CIE-LAB 41.541, -37.698, 33.268
XYZ 7.074, 12.206, 3.902
xyY 0.305, 0.527, 12.206
CIE-LCH 41.541, 50.278, 138.572
CIE-LUV 41.541, -31.138, 40.956
Hunter-Lab 34.937, -24.994, 17.833
Binary 00101001, 01110000, 00100111

Shades and Tints of #297027

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a04 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.
